2011-09-13 49 views
0
指定頁面

我寫我的web.config文件如下爲什麼我無法重定向到使用的Web.Config

<authentication mode="Forms"> 
    <forms loginUrl="Index.aspx" defaultUrl="Login.aspx" timeout="20"/> 
</authentication> 

是本地的好作品,但是當我要生活,我不能看到Index.aspx作爲我的默認頁面。相反,我能看到Default.aspx我有。有什麼問題behingdthis

+0

禁止訪問您的網站的某些地區生效,你的意思是,當他們在網站的網址,輸入用戶被自動定向到Default.aspx的? –

+0

'Tim B James'是的,當我點擊一些'xyz.com'時,它將我重定向到默認頁面,而不是給出的頁面 – Dotnet

+0

感覺就像您已經被識別爲已登錄並因此轉發通過您的登錄頁。如果你清除所有的臨時互聯網文件/ cookies,你會得到同樣的結果嗎? – dougajmcdonald

回答

2

要回答你的問題,並繼續您的評論。

您的用戶打算去Default.aspx,因爲在您的IIS設置中,Default.aspx將被設置爲default document。您想要指定Index.aspx

的authenitcation設置只有當您使用Location Authorisation

+0

但爲什麼本地工作對我來說很好 – Dotnet

+0

本地你可能會在你的項目中設置Index.aspx頁面作爲你的啓動頁面。 –

+0

因此,我們必須根據文檔更改頁面並更換右側 – Dotnet

相關問題